Commercial ice machine pricing in Hoboken is influenced by daily ice output, condenser configuration, water quality conditions, and expected duty cycle. While equipment price matters, long-term operating cost — including electricity, water usage, filtration, and maintenance — often represents the largest expense over time.
Facilities comparing systems frequently review commercial ice machine prices alongside energy efficiency to evaluate total cost of ownership, not just upfront purchase cost.

Proper sizing depends on daily ice usage, peak service periods, and whether ice is mission-critical to operations. Facilities in Hobokenoften size systems with production buffers to maintain output during maintenance cycles or unexpected demand spikes.
Operating cost is influenced by condenser efficiency, ambient temperature, water conditions, filtration requirements, and maintenance intervals. Facilities operating in warmer regions or high-volume environments often prioritize energy-efficient systems to control long-term expense.
Yes. Many commercial ice systems are designed to scale. Facilities expanding from Hobokeninto additional locations across New Jerseyoften add modular machines or secondary systems rather than replacing existing infrastructure. Planning scalability early reduces future capital disruption.
